Output 583e91291567edd36ef8747eea2be4cd4141ea33d4d357e46c8cdf73d8e3b973:6

value
171139448
script pubkey
OP_0 OP_PUSHBYTES_20 2f9a384785b3d78e836df746ffa744493caa21ee
address
bc1q97drs3u9k0tcaqmd7ar0lf6yfy725g0w3kj6cm
transaction
583e91291567edd36ef8747eea2be4cd4141ea33d4d357e46c8cdf73d8e3b973
spent
true